Cato

Closed
E Commerce St
San Antonio, TX 78205

Cato is a cozy café nestled in the heart of San Antonio, TX, offering a selection of gourmet coffee and freshly baked pastries.

With a warm and inviting atmosphere, Cato provides a relaxing space for customers to unwind and enjoy a quiet moment away from the hustle and bustle of the city.

Generated from their business information

Own this business?
See a problem?

You might also like